Successfully reported this slideshow.
Your SlideShare is downloading. ×

Web matrix でプログラミング生放送してみた

Ad
Ad
Ad
Ad
Ad
Ad
Ad
Ad
Ad
Ad
Ad

Check these out next

1 of 15 Ad
Advertisement

More Related Content

Similar to Web matrix でプログラミング生放送してみた (20)

Advertisement

Web matrix でプログラミング生放送してみた

  1. 1. WebMatrix で プログラミング生放送 してみた プログラミング生放送勉強会 第22回@松山(2013/03/30)
  2. 2. 自己紹介 https://twitter.com/daruyanagi
  3. 3. だるやなぎメーカー http://daruyanagi.azurewebsites.net/
  4. 4. だるにゃとほてぷ いつもニコニコあなたのまわりに蔓延るだるさん
  5. 5. 謎のキモい組み換え生物 daruyama
  6. 6. まぁ、それはともかく この前の品川のプロ生見た?
  7. 7. なんか @5zj がやってたな プログラミング生放送@プログラミング生放送勉強会 第20回@ 品川 | プログラミング生放送
  8. 8. SignalR+ Visual Studio 拡張機能 で プログラミング生放送 やと? ......その発想はなかったな。
  9. 9. SignalR とは 特集:ASP.NET SignalR入門(前編):ASP.NET SignalRを知る (1/5) - @IT
  10. 10. SignalR ・リアルタイム ・双方向(サーバー&クライアント) ・非同期通信 ・RPC (メソッドをたたく)
  11. 11. SignalR WebSocket よりも上のレイヤの高レベル API WebSocket Server-Sent Events iframe Ajax ロングポーリング(Long-polling) 環境によってこれらの技術を自動で使い分ける。 クライアントは JavaScript / .NET / iOS とか? いろいろある。
  12. 12. これ、 WebMatrix でもできね? サーバーは SignalR ⇒ WebMatrix でサーバー書いて、Azure WebSites でホスト クライアントは……? ⇒ WebMatrix の拡張機能! ・MEF と呼ばれる技術が利用されている ・Visual Studio(Express でもできる)が必要
  13. 13. 御託はいいから見せろよ
  14. 14. 反省点 ・ドキュメントがなくて(じっくり探す時間もなくて)、プル 型(ボタンを押さないとダメ)の更新しかできない → File Watcher があるので、ファイルの保存で更新するのは難し くない → キー入力をトリガーにするのも可能であるはず → もっと探せば API あるかなぁ...... ・一応認証機能ぐらいはほしいなぁ → URL + 拡張機能 でだれでもサーバーが使い放題!! (Free の Auzre WebSites は使いすぎたらロックされるからいい けど)
  15. 15. おわり サーバーのコードは CodePlex にあります。 (ぐぐれよびんぐれよ) クライアントのコードも後日公開すると思います。

×